Table 1. The average (± SEM) absolute SCFA levels (mM) in the luminal content of the M-SHIME units, 42 h after inoculation with fecal samples of different human subjects: healthy, UC remission and UC relapse (n = 4).
Healthy | UC remission | UC relapse | |
---|---|---|---|
Acetate | 54.0 ± 3.8 | 40.7 ± 4.9 | 46.1 ± 6.0 |
Propionate | 7.3 ± 0.3 | 6.2 ± 3.2 | 9.4 ± 1.4 |
Butyrate | 23.6 ± 5.3 | 18.9 ± 4.2 | 23.8 ± 3.4 |
Valerate | 0.6 ± 0.6 | 1.6 ± 0.8 | 0.7 ± 0.6 |
Caproate | 1.5 ± 1.5 | 3.6 ± 2.8 | 0.1 ± 0.1 |
Branched SCFA | 2.0 ± 1.6 | 5.1 ± 1.2 | 3.2 ± 1.3 |
Total SCFA | 89.1 ± 2.5 | 76.2 ± 4.6 | 83.3 ± 7.6 |
